Understanding the Brightness Trap: Why 15,000 Nit TVs Can Fail to Impress

Many enthusiasts assume that cranking up the brightness will automatically lead to better HDR and more vivid images. But the truth is, with ultra-high nit levels, your TV can easily fall into the washed-out trap if not properly calibrated. This is because overly bright displays without the right contrast management cause HDR highlights to clip, losing detail in the brightest scenes. As a result, even a TV boasting 15,000 nits can look dull, and in some cases, even damage your eyes with glare and clipping.

Early on, I made the mistake of simply increasing the brightness to maximum, thinking more is better. That’s a common rookie error. Proper contrast and HDR tuning are crucial. For example, mastering contrast control can help you avoid HDR clipping, ensuring that those spectacular highlights are rendered accurately without washing out the overall picture. Adjust Your Contrast Settings for Natural Brightness

Start by setting your contrast control to around 50-60% and gradually increase it while watching test scenes. In my experience, pushing it too high caused clipping, washing out highlights. I calibrated my contrast, noticing brighter skies and more detailed explosions without losing shadow detail. Think of contrast like the sail on a boat—too high, and it flops; just right, and it catches just enough wind to glide smoothly.

Fine-Tune Local Dimming to Enhance Depth

Next, dive into your local dimming settings—these control zones turn off lighting behind dark areas, improving black levels. In my setup, enabling high contrast local dimming boosted black depth and prevented blooming. For precise control, disable auto-dimming temporarily, set local dimming to high, and watch for halo effects—if halos appear, reduce the zone intensity in the menu. This adjustment contributes significantly to scene realism, making bright scenes vibrant and dark scenes immersive.

Utilize Tone Mapping for Preserving Highlights

Tone mapping intelligently compresses high dynamic range signals into your display’s capabilities. To optimize it, navigate to your TV’s HDR settings and enable tone mapping if available. I found that enabling adaptive tone mapping prevented highlight clipping during explosions, keeping details vibrant. Think of tone mapping as a quality filter—without it, your bright scenes might burn out, but with it, they shine with detail and brilliance.

I personally rely on a combination of professional calibration software and hardware calibration tools to ensure consistent quality. One of my favorites is CalMAN, a calibration suite that integrates with personal colorimeters like the X-Rite i1Display Pro Plus. This combination allows me to perform scene-by-scene calibration, fine-tuning tone mapping and contrast controls dynamically, especially as firmware updates and ambient conditions change. Using these tools, I regularly verify peak brightness, black levels, and highlight handling, which are critical for HDR content.

Another essential aspect I emphasize is keeping your TV firmware updated. Manufacturers often release updates that optimize contrast algorithms, tone mapping, and local dimming performance, significantly influencing long-term picture quality. To streamline this process, I subscribe to manufacturer support alerts and check for updates via the TV’s settings menu or support websites.

In addition, ambient light measurement tools like the DataColor SpyderX Elite help me monitor room lighting conditions, allowing me to adjust HDR and contrast settings to suit my environment continually. This synergy of hardware and software ensures my display maintains its vibrant output without excessive manual recalibration.
